Wakefield is a charming small town nestled in northeastern Nebraska, with a population of around 1,500 residents. It is located in Dixon County and is known for its friendly community, strong family values, and tight-knit atmosphere.

The town has a rich history that dates back to the late 1800s when it was founded as a railroad town. Wakefield was named after the head carpenter for the Chicago, St. Paul, Minneapolis and Omaha Railroad, Albert Wakefield. The railroad played a significant role in the town’s development, and it continues to be an important part of Wakefield’s economy today.
